Factors Affecting Pricing

Installing a vapor barrier in Gary, IN, typically involves selecting appropriate materials and ensuring proper coverage to prevent moisture issues in basements or crawl spaces. Understanding the scope and options can help in planning a project that meets specific needs and local building requirements.

  • Materials: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heets, usually 6 mil or thicker, designed to resist moisture transmission.
  • Size and Scope: Installation coverage varies based on the area, often encompassing entire basement or crawl space floors and walls, with typical sheets spanning 10 to 20 feet in length.
  • Labor Complexity: The process generally involves cleaning the surface, laying out the barrier, and sealing seams, which can range from straightforward to moderately complex depending on space size and obstructions.
  • Permitting: Local building codes in Gary, IN, may require permits for moisture barrier installation, especially in new construction or major renovations.
  • Additional Options: Considerations may include vapor barrier tapes, sealing around penetrations, and insulation integration for enhanced moisture control.
